实时建站全流程技术解析
|
实时建站是现代运维工作中常见的一项任务,涉及从需求分析到部署上线的全流程。作为主机运维者,我们需要对整个流程有清晰的认知,确保每个环节都符合安全、高效的标准。
AI绘图结果,仅供参考 在开始之前,首先要明确业务需求和技术指标。这包括网站类型、访问量预估、功能模块以及预期的性能表现。这些信息将直接影响后续的技术选型和架构设计。选择合适的服务器环境是关键步骤之一。根据业务特性,我们可能需要使用物理服务器、云主机或容器化部署。同时,操作系统的选择也需考虑兼容性和维护成本,Linux系统因其稳定性和灵活性成为主流。 接下来是软件栈的搭建。Web服务器如Nginx或Apache,数据库如MySQL或PostgreSQL,以及应用服务器如Tomcat或Node.js都需要合理配置。确保各组件之间的兼容性,并做好版本管理,避免因依赖冲突导致故障。 数据安全同样不可忽视。我们需要配置SSL证书实现HTTPS加密传输,设置防火墙规则限制非法访问,并定期进行漏洞扫描和日志审计。备份策略也必须提前制定,防止数据丢失。 部署阶段需要通过CI/CD工具实现自动化流程,减少人为错误。测试环境验证通过后,逐步将代码推送到生产环境,同时监控系统资源使用情况,确保稳定性。 上线后的运维工作同样重要。通过监控工具持续跟踪性能指标,及时发现并处理异常。同时,根据用户反馈不断优化架构,提升用户体验。 整个流程中,沟通协作是保障效率的重要因素。与开发、测试、产品等团队保持密切联系,确保信息同步,避免因理解偏差造成返工。 作为主机运维者,我们不仅要掌握技术细节,更要具备全局思维,确保每一个环节都经得起考验。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

